Xcel Energy's 6.25% Junior Subordinated Notes due 2085 (XELLL) are currently trading at $24.1, representing a modest gain of +0.08% for the session. The security is positioned above its support level of $22.89 but remains below the resistance area near $25.31. This stable price action reflects a balanced supply-demand dynamic as investors assess the yield on offer relative to the broader fixed-income landscape.

Trading volume for XELLL has been consistent with recent averages, suggesting no unusual accumulation or distribution patterns. As a junior subordinated note issued by a regulated utility holding company, XELLL carries a credit profile that benefits from Xcel Energy’s stable earnings and investment-grade rating. The current yield, calculated from the $1.5625 annual interest per note (6.25% of $25 par value), is approximately 6.5% at the $24.1 price level. This yield places the security in a range that may appeal to income-focused investors, especially in an environment where long-term Treasury yields have shown volatility. Sector positioning for utility debt remains relatively attractive due to the defensive nature of the industry and consistent cash flows. However, the junior subordinated structure introduces additional risk compared to senior debt, and market participants are monitoring interest rate expectations and credit spreads. The slight upward movement of +0.08% today suggests a modest demand pull, possibly from buyers seeking to lock in yields near the lower end of the recent trading range.

The identified support at $22.89 has been tested multiple times over recent months, providing a floor that has held during periods of broader market weakness. Resistance at $25.31 represents a level where selling pressure has historically emerged as the price approaches par value. Price action indicates that XELLL continues to trade within a defined channel, with recent oscillations staying between the mid-$23 area and the mid-$24 area. From a technical perspective, relative strength index readings may be in the neutral to slightly oversold range on a medium-term basis, while moving averages—such as the 50-day and 200-day—could be converging near current levels, suggesting a consolidation phase. The lack of a clear directional breakout implies that the market is waiting for a catalyst. The yield spread versus comparable utility bonds remains within a normal range, reflecting no unusual credit concerns.

Looking ahead, XELLL may continue to trade within the established support and resistance zone unless a significant catalyst emerges. A move toward the $25.31 resistance could occur if interest rates decline or if Xcel Energy’s credit outlook improves. Conversely, a break below $22.89 might be triggered by a rise in long-term rates or a downgrade in the utility’s credit rating. Factors that could influence performance include Federal Reserve policy decisions, inflation data, and overall demand for income-generating securities. Investors might also watch for any changes in the company’s leverage or dividend policy that could affect its junior subordinated debt. The maturity date in 2085 means long-term rate expectations have a substantial influence on the security’s price. Caution is warranted given the junior subordinated nature, which exposes holders to lower priority in the capital structure.
